For example, suppose frameset.html is the frameset document and page.html is
the page that must be displayed in the frame named UFRAME. Then this HTML code
would be present in frameset.html:
<FRAMESET COLS="*,*">
<FRAME SRC="cframe.html", NAME="CFrame">
<FRAME SRC="page.html", NAME="UFrame">
</FRAMESET>
And this code would be present in page.html:
<FORM NAME="THEFORM">
<SELECT NAME="SELECTCTRL"> <OPTION> </SELECT>
</FORM>
This call would invoke the method for this example:
displayBase ("page.html", "THEFORM", "UFRAME", "SELECTCTRL");
Method displayOverlay
Purpose
Sets the context of the HTML page on which subsequent methods such as
display() and accept() work.
Syntax
void displayOverlay (String overlayScreenName,
String overlayArea,
String screenIdentifier,
int rowOffset,
int colOffset)
